Job Overview:

LPL Financial is seeking an IAM Senior Business Analyst to join its Information Security department.  The primary responsibility of this position is capture and document the Identity & Access Management (IAM) requirements working with Access Management, IAM Governance, LPL Business Owner and Application Owner and multiple other stakeholders. The role will work closely with IAM Architects, Scrum Masters, Application developers and vendors to capture requirements, design, build, configure, test and implement IAM solutions that meet the business needs of the enterprise and are aligned and consistent with enterprise IT strategies and plans.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Participate in the requirement gathering of an IAM technical vision that can be articulated across functional groups, aligned with IAM projects, and that delivers business agility.

  • Working with the Product owner and the team to create a tactical focus of refining the “What”, “Why” and “When of priorities.

  • Analyzing and documenting functional & nonfunctional requirements for various IAM domains such as Access Management, Identity Life cycle Management, Reporting, and analytics.

  • Attends and collaborates in all team ceremonies and is available to the team answer questions about all business and technical requirements.

  • Prior experience in creating IAM governance collaterals such as policies, procedures, standards, and guidelines, Role types and User Access Reviews etc.

  • Good grasp of operational, regulatory, and other risks related to the area of Access and Identity Lifecycle Services

  • Facilitate requirements gathering sessions using a variety of techniques that include interviews, surveys, review of historical data, workshop sessions and structured walkthrough of the processes

  • Able to work independently with business stakeholders to capture IAM use cases and define IAM processes.

  • Client Management: experienced in effectively interacting and communicating with business partners.

  • Experienced in managing multiple dependencies between IAM projects with a proven track record of successful IAM deployments.

Requirements:

  • 5+ years’ experience as a Business Analyst, implementing enterprise Identity Management, Access Management and security solutions (E.g. SailPoint, CA, IBM, BMC, Sun, Oracle, Saviynt, ForgeRock, etc.) in client environments.

  • 2+ years direct experience working with Scrum/Kanban teams in an Agile environment.

  • Experience and understanding of PAM and IAM concepts and best practices, such as Identity Lifecycle, Roles, RBAC, Segregations of Duty, and workflow development.
